OverviewTwelve-year-old David Andrews had to swallow his grief when his dad was killed on a rainy night in Georgia. Not only was he faced with having to care for his mother who completely fell apart when his father was killed, but then he had to help his mother pack up their belongings for their move to Florida and into a single-wide mobile home. His dog helped him face all his responsibilities plus starting a completely new school in Florida. Just when things seemed to settle down and David and his mother could get on with life, two nasty criminals and a mean neighbor came into their lives and caused chaos and near death to some.
